Cheap coveralls: $1,150 saved, $4,200 lost

In March 2022, I ordered 500 generic coveralls for our painting and insulation crews. The unit price was about 60% of what we'd paid for DuPont Tyvek protective clothing on previous orders. The marketing page said "comparable to Tyvek." The sample I inspected in my office felt strong enough. I approved the bulk order without a second thought.

Three days into the job, the site supervisor called. The suits were tearing at the seams—not after a full shift, within the first hour. One worker had paint thinner soak through the forearm while cleaning a spray gun. Nobody ended up in the hospital, but that sentence is a lot closer than I ever want to be.

Let me break the damage down:

  • $1,150 - the rejected order of generic coveralls
  • $1,850 - the emergency replacement order of DuPont Tyvek protective clothing
  • $1,200 - idle crew time, expedited shipping, supervisor overtime

Total: $4,200 to learn that the cheaper suit wasn't cheaper.

The detail I originally missed: Tyvek material's particle and splash resistance is a tested performance specification, not marketing language. When I finally laid the spec sheets side by side, the generic product's own data showed lower barrier performance in nearly every category. I just hadn't read past the first page.

Since that failure, I've standardized on DuPont Tyvek protective clothing for any work involving fine particles, insulation, lead paint, or chemical splash risk. The spec sheet is the contract between the product and your safety plan. If the two don't match, the product loses.

Can you wash leather gloves? I found out by ruining $890 of them

The most common question I get about hand protection: can you wash leather gloves?

Short answer: yes. But never in a washing machine. I learned this the expensive way.

In September 2022, a demolition crew returned around 240 pairs of leather work gloves—I want to say 240, I'd have to check the log—thick with grease and grime. Thinking I'd save close to $900 in replacement costs, I told my assistant to run them through the machine with regular detergent.

Don't do this.

The agitation breaks down leather fibers. The detergent strips natural oils. The spin cycle permanently deforms the leather. What came out of that washer looked like crumpled paper bags, and I wrote off approximately $890 of gloves that afternoon.

What actually works: hand wash leather gloves in lukewarm water with leather-specific cleaner or saddle soap. Air-dry them away from heat and direct sunlight. Once dry, condition them with leather balm or mink oil. If the gloves are heavily contaminated with chemicals or solvents, don't clean them at all—replace them. Replacement is cheap insurance compared to what my laundry experiment cost.

One note: this advice applies to leather gloves specifically. Synthetic cut-resistant gloves, like those made from Kevlar fiber, are generally machine-washable but need their own care routine. Always check the care label before you pick a cleaning method.

Schmidt workwear vs. budget pants: the math surprised me

I used to believe Schmidt workwear was overpriced because of the brand name. So in Q1 2024, I ran a small comparison. Twenty pairs of budget work pants at $28 each versus twenty pairs of Schmidt workwear at $54 each, rotated through the same crews doing the same fabrication and grinding work.

After eight weeks: 14 of the 20 budget pairs had failed seams, torn pockets, or significant knee wear. One of the 20 Schmidt pairs had a minor seam issue.

Then I did the cost-per-week math, and it flipped my view completely. The budget pants averaged about 12 weeks of usable life: $2.33 per week. The Schmidt workwear averaged 38 weeks: $1.42 per week. The "expensive" workwear was 40% cheaper per week of actual use.

That's the value-over-price calculation I should have been running for years.

A pre-purchase checklist that prevents repeat mistakes

Here's the checklist I now use for every PPE and workwear order. It's printed on a card in my office, and it has caught 47 potential errors in the past 18 months:

  1. Verify the hazard spec against the actual work. Not the sales page, not the photo—the spec sheet.
  2. Calculate total cost per week or per use cycle. Include shipping. For small orders, USPS flat-rate boxes (usps.com) keep delivery predictable, but for bulk PPE, freight can add 5–10% to the total.
  3. Run a small test batch first. Twenty units with a real crew tell you more than any showroom sample.
  4. Check certifications, not claims. Per FTC advertising guidelines (ftc.gov), marketing must be truthful and substantiated—but that's a legal floor, not a performance guarantee.
  5. Confirm cleaning and maintenance requirements before purchase. Ask how the product is meant to be cared for. That single question would have saved my leather gloves.

When buying cheap is genuinely fine

I'm not saying unit price never matters. It does. And sometimes the cheaper product is the right call:

  • Disposable items for tasks with no safety risk
  • One-time, short-duration jobs where replacement is already expected
  • Non-safety-rated products where failure has no consequence

That's the honest boundary. For anything that touches worker safety—Tyvek suits, gloves, workwear, or barriers for kids—the value-over-price calculation is the only calculation that makes sense.
